eHealth refers to the use of information and communication technologies in healthcare and aims to improve access and equity in healthcare services. While eHealth solutions have proliferated in sub-Saharan Africa, there has been limited coordination and integration, resulting in duplication and unsustainable pilot projects. Key challenges to eHealth adoption include a lack of infrastructure like reliable electricity, insufficient training and support, and low digital literacy among the public. Potential solutions include standardized training, increased government support, using alternative energy sources, and minimizing further duplication through better coordination among stakeholders.
